A primary focus this year is on preventive maintenance. It is a little-known fact that minor upkeep can postpone the need for more serious repairs. For instance, cleaning out refrigerator coils or ensuring your dishwasher's filter is unclogged can go a long way in keeping your devices running smoothly. By doing so, you not only extend the life of your appliances but also save money in the long run.

Another key aspect of the event is teaching attendees how to diagnose common malfunctions. For Whirlpool appliances, familiarizing yourself with error codes is essential. For example, if your Whirlpool washing machine’s LED display flashes an F20 error, it might indicate a water inlet problem, which could be as simple as checking the water supply faucets.

While some issues might call for professional attention, knowing when it’s time to call in a Whirlpool appliance repair specialist can save unnecessary expenses. Sometimes, replacing a minor part such as a gasket or a seal is far more cost-effective than purchasing a new machine.

Choosing a reliable service center is another crucial topic. A simple online search will reveal a plethora of reviews and ratings, ensuring you select a repair service well-versed in Whirlpool technology. Opting for certified technicians guarantees that your appliances receive the care they need.

Remember, safety cannot be overstressed. If you're keen on tackling some DIY repair tasks, always ensure you unplug the appliance first to avoid any electrical hazards. Small steps like these increase the safety of your home repair endeavors.
